Transaction 714305c9cb69020ed848892b23af1ec0033dd6ab1973c0a832569d111b78c8f5
1 Input
1 Output
-
714305c9cb69020ed848892b23af1ec0033dd6ab1973c0a832569d111b78c8f5:0
- value
- 2900711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b0e923b356754be1ed32780e884576010ec415d OP_EQUAL
- address
- 3QaUz7reNUKRTcQkTPcBD6GLgYMhEuAEca